Cookies
We use cookies on this website to ensure the integrity of the ordering and registration process and to personalise the website. A cookie is a small text file that is transferred from a website server to your hard drive. Cookies cannot be used to run programs or deliver viruses to a computer. Cookies are assigned exclusively to you and they can only be read by a web server in the domain that issued the cookie to you.
Cookies are primarily for convenience and help save time. For example, when you personalise a web page or navigate within a WebSite, the cookie helps the WebSite remember your specific information on successive visits. This makes it easier to deliver content that is relevant to you, navigate the site and more. When you return to the site, the information you previously provided can be retrieved so that you can easily use the features of the site that you have customised.
You have the option to accept or reject cookies. Most web browsers automatically accept cookies, but you can usually change your browser settings to reject cookies. If you choose to decline cookies, you may not be able to fully experience the interactive features of this website or other websites you visit.
